## Tuning

Canary gating for the Larkspur deploy pipeline. Gates evaluate error rate, p95 latency delta, and saturation against baseline over a sliding window. A gate trip halts promotion and pages the rotation; no auto-rollback yet. Loosen nothing without a sync decision — last quarter's flapping came from a hand-edited window. Current gate constants follow.

limits module of tafop-hahop:
WEIGHTS = {
    "julmir": 223,
    "belox": 987,
    "lamion": 470,
    "pelath": 609,
    "fraok": 1010,
    "eliion": 343,
    "drudor": 342,
}

Subject: Partner SFTP drop — new owner

Hi,

As you review the pending changes to the Harborline ingest scripts, note that ownership of the partner SFTP drop is changing at the end of the month. This includes key rotation, the nightly pull job, and the quarantine folder for malformed files. Review comments on the retry logic should still go through the normal PR flow, but questions about drop-folder conventions or partner onboarding now go to the new owner. The incoming owner is listed below.

signatory, tagaf-bahaf: Praael Fenmir Rusok

# Build Provenance — SproutMinder Scheduler

Hey, welcome aboard! Every SproutMinder release is built on the Greenhouse CI cluster, signed, and logged before it ships to the watering hubs. Don't trust any binary that isn't in the provenance ledger — rebuilds happen nightly, so stale artifacts get purged fast. The current verified build token is recorded below.

session token of tajef-bageg = htk21_5d90d574934f3ccae6437

Subject: RemindLoop 4.2 released

Hello plugin authors,

RemindLoop 4.2, the appointment reminder job used by the Calder Street Clinic deployment, is now on the stable channel. The scheduling hook API is unchanged; the message-template hook now receives a locale field, so update any plugins that format reminder text. Deprecated v1 hooks will be removed in 4.4. Test against the staging queue before publishing updates. For support requests, please quote the build token that appears below this message.

trace token, fafog-kageg: htk4_98e6